IP ratings might sound like tech jargon, but they're simpler than IKEA instructions. The "6" means total dust resistance - no more Sahara Desert scenarios in your battery cabinet. The "5"? That's protection against water jets from any direction. Basically, these systems laugh in the face of:

Modern EV charging stations are adopting lithium-ion energy storage systems faster than you can say "range anxiety," and there's good reason. These systems act like energy reservoirs, storing electricity during off-peak hours and releasing it when drivers need fast charging.
